€500 taxi trip from Tralee to Sligo court

-

A PAKISTANI asylum seeker has been charged with conning a Tralee taxi driver out of €500 after he allegedly made off without paying for a taxi ride from Kerry to Sligo where he was due to appear before the local district court.

Waleed Khan (28) a native of Pakistan who lives at the Atlas House asylum centre in Tralee, had been due in court to answer a charge of engaging in threatenin­g or abusive behaviour at Sligo University Hospital on July 16 last.

When he arrived at Sligo District Court on September 7 Mr Khan was charged with dishonestl­y by deception, arising from the allegedly unpaid bill for the taxi that he had used to get to the court that morning.

The court heard that Mr Khan had agreed to pay Tralee taxi driver Pat Godley €500 to take him to Sligo but that on arriving in Sligo town he didn’t hand over the cash.

“Is the taxi driver here? asked Judge Kevin Kilrane. “We sent him home,” said the arresting Garda Martha Carter.

The court heard Mr Khan – who has no family in Ireland – has lived in the country for a number of years.

Waleed Khan disputed the taxi driver’s claim about the fare and said that a €300 fee had been agreed before they left Tralee.

Defence solicitor Tom MacSharry said Mr Khan had moved to Tralee from the Globe House asylum centre in Sligo after “having some difficulti­es there”.

Mr Khan said he would “definitely” pay the outstandin­g taxi bill and intended to do so by getting a loan from some Pakistani friends who are living in Riverstown village near Sligo town.

Judge Kilrane remanded Mr Khan in custody to a special sitting of Sligo District Court at 9pm on September 8.

At that special sitting, Khan elected for trial by judge and jury on the dishonesty charge.

There was no mention of any money being present in court for the taxi driver.

Free legal aid was granted and Judge Kilrane remanded Mr Khan in custody, with consent to bail to appear at Harristown District Court in Castlerea when a date will be set for his case to come before the Circuit Criminal Courts.
